The tire changer machine operates by securely clamping the wheel and tire assembly in place while the machine uses a combination of levers, arms, and rollers to remove the old tire and install a new one. Some advanced machines even have robotic arms that can perform the entire process without any human intervention. This not only speeds up the process but also ensures accuracy and prevents any damage to the rims or tires.

As technology continues to advance, tyre changer machines are also evolving to meet the changing needs of the automotive industry. Some newer models come equipped with features such as touch screen interfaces, automatic bead breakers, laser-guided mounting systems, and even diagnostic capabilities. These advanced features not only make the tire changing process easier and more efficient but also help technicians identify any potential issues with the tires or wheels.
